ANNAPOLIS TO SOLOMON ISLAND ANCHORAGE

October 23, 2011

We departed the inner Annapolis harbor mooring buoy at 0954 hrs this morning.  Our plan is to run South about 40 nm to Solomon Is (38 deg 19.9' N x 76 deg 27.6' W) and anchor for the night.  The wind was light and on the nose so, once again, we motored.  The day started off with a chill in the air but warmed up as the day progressed.

We dropped anchor in a charming little basin just as the sun was setting in 17' of water.  It was a quiet night and we enjoyed the rest.  The Chesapeake is a great place to find anchorages.  Even the small creeks have enough water depth to accommodate a 6' draft.  The area is a yachting paradise except for the cold winters.
